Miranda Licence, 24, forgot how to walk after waking up from a nap. Doctors from Brisbane Hospital unable to diagnose her strange condition. Making matters stranger, she was still able to run and walk backwards. She was later diagnosed with functional neurological symptom disorder. After seven weeks in hospital she was able to learn how to walk again.

She is back to her regular routine of running, but says she sometimes chooses to walk instead - because walking makes her feel stronger.

Functional Neurological Disorders (FND's) is the name given for symptoms in the body which appear to be caused by problems in the nervous system but which are not caused by a physical neurological disease or disorder. Health professionals sometimes call these disorders ‘medically unexplained’, psychosomatic or somatisation. We prefer the term ‘functional’ which just means that the body is not functioning quite as it should.
